Q: Is 10,557,520 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 10,557,520 is a composite number.

Why is 10,557,520 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 10,557,520 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 8 10 16 20 40 80 131,969 263,938 527,876 659,845 1,055,752 1,319,690 2,111,504 2,639,380 5,278,760 and 10,557,520, with no remainder.

Since 10,557,520 cannot be divided by just 1 and 10,557,520, it is a composite number.
